Incest

/ĭn'-sĕstˌ/ · In·cest · IPA /ˈɪn.sɛst/
01 n. The crime of cohabitation or sexual intercourse between persons related within the degrees wherein marriage is prohibited by law;

Phrases & compounds
Spiritual incest — The crime of cohabitation committed between persons who have a spiritual alliance by means of baptism or confirmation.
